As the adoption of virtualization technology accelerates in the datacenter, a high level of uncertainty remains on how to implement PCI security controls and how assessors measure the implementation of these controls in a virtualized environment. Many organizations have limited deployment because of concerns over proving that virtualized environments are compliant and audit ready. With PCI version 1.2 set to release in early October and the PCI Security Standards Council's decision to postpone the Virtualization Special Interest Group (SIG), industry guidance on how to meet PCI DSS compliance audits in virtualized environments is not widely available.
